Those problems which global warming, environmental pollution, resource depletion, the worsening ecological economy attract the attention of the world, so circular economy is proposed to save the earth, the one of the ways to improve the condition is the environment management.and the essence of environmental management finally locates on resources losses.While micro-level resource losses management lack of methods, data comprehensive study angle and systematic research and so on. The purpose of resources losses research is to promote the development of circular economy.Firstly, the resources losses related are defined. The resources losses are these resources inputs which are not reflected the final product within the enterprise, including waste water, waste gas (carbon emissions) and solid waste, whose character is not fully used, thus resources losses have the two forms of physical and value. The physical form shows its environmental effect,while value form expresses the cost of resource consumption.So the resources losses quantification include the cost of resources losses and its external environmental impact based on the economic and environmental view.How to quantify the resources losses in physical and value is a problem to solve. Combining material flow analysis(MFA) which is a method for material circulation analysis on macroscopic study and traditional cost accounting which is a method for value transfer on microscopic,which brings about material flow cost accounting (MFCA) to solve the quantification problems of resource losses in "physical flow-value flow", provides a method to support. Quantitative resources losses make material flow and cost flow transparent in the enterprise, which can make the enterprise to rapidly find the economic and environmental improvement, and provide data support for the development of low-carbon economy.A great challenge is how to make the quantitative resources losses data serve for low carbon economy.The features of circular economy with "3R"(Reduce、Reuse、Recycle) indicate resource losses minimization or resource utilization maximization. Therefore control and evaluation of the resources losses put on the agenda. The goals of resources losses control are to maximize economic efficiency and resource utilization,and to minimize environmental and human hazards. Current resource losses control has two methods which are technical control and economic control,while accounting control has more advantages in internal control.The two-dimensional analysis method of "material flow-value flow" is used to diagnose the link between resource losses and its pollution to the environment,which support the decisions for production equipment investment and low-carbon economic cost-benefit analysis. Quantitative control of resources losses have two forms,one is not to change the material flow,another is to change it. Two ways (not change the material flow) which are to build an accounting control system in the production process or make up a supply chain cooperation model (SCCM) for cooperation in the supply chain reach resources lossess control.Similar to change the material flow,two ways aim to control resources lossess, one is investment on equipment,another is to change the end of the material flow.The evaluation purpose of environmental performance for resources losses is to minimize the losses and environmental impact and control pollution behavior,which serves for the development of circular economy. Eco-efficiency index meets the requirements. Then the index system is determined based on "material flow-value flow"with resources inputs, consumption, recycling and output. And data envelopment analysis (DEA) achieves a comprehensive evaluation.Finally, a thermal power enterprise carries on a comprehensive application of resources losses quantification, control and evaluation,which comprehensively and systematically reflects resources losses research how to promote circular economic development.
